inaccurate shot
[/ɪnˈækjərət ʃɑːt/]
noun phrasepl: inaccurate shots
tiro impreciso
1. A shot in sports (basketball, soccer, firearms, etc.) that misses the intended target or goal due to poor aim or execution
The basketball player took an inaccurate shot that bounced off the rim.
O jogador de basquete fez um tiro impreciso que ricocheteou no aro.
2. An attempt or effort that fails to achieve the desired result with precision
His inaccurate shot from the penalty spot cost the team the match.
Seu tiro impreciso da marca de pênalti custou a partida ao time.
In Brazilian sports culture, particularly in soccer and basketball, commentators frequently criticize inaccurate shots as a key factor in match outcomes. The term is widely understood across all social classes and is common in sports bars and casual conversations about games.
